Weekend Box Office - "Jackass Presents: Bad Grandpa" was number one bringing in $32 million, "Gravity" starring George Clooney and Sandra Bullock had the number two spot with $20.3 million, "Captain Phillips" starring Tom Hanks rounded out the top three with $11.8 million.

Another recently released trailer that I have been waiting for with baited breath is "X-Men: Days of Future Past". Bryan Singer, director of the first and second X-Men movies returns to the franchise and incorporates the casts of the X-Men franchise with the cast of the prequel "X-Men: The First Class", as well as, adding some faces by introducing some popular characters from the comic books. Brace yourself.
 
 
 
 
The newest DC Animated movie to be released on DVD/ Bluray is "Justice League: War" the origin story for DC Comics The New 52 relaunch. This is both the origin story for The New 52 version of The Justice League and the characters first time meeting each other. While this is not a literal adaptation of the actual graphic novel this animated movie looks to be as exciting and entertaining as the actual illustrated story was. Weekend Box Office - "Gravity" starring George Clooney and Sandra Bullock was number one for the third week in a row bringing in $31.03 million, "Captain Phillips" starring Tom Hanks was number two with $17.3 million, and the horror remake "Carrie" rounded out the top three with $17 million.

Weekend Box Office - "Gravity" starring George Clooney and Sandra Bullock was number one for a second week with $44.27 million, "Captain Phillips" starring Tom Hanks was number two with $26 million, and "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s 2" rounded out the top three with $14.2 million. Worth honorable mention simply because of its status as a sequel of a movie originally based on a phony trailer is "Machete Kills" which opened at a distant forth with $3.8 million. "Carrie" based on a book by Stephen King and made into movie starring Sissy Spacek  back in 1976 is coming to theatres again this time starring Julianne Moore and Chloe Grace Moretz in the title role. The movie opens this coming Friday and we'll soon know if this version packs the same hard punches as the 1976 version.

Weekend Box Office -  "Gravity" starring George Clooney and Sandra Bullock was number one with $55.55 million, "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s 2" came in at number two with $21.5 million, "Runner, Runner" was number three with $7.6 million.

Director Joss Whedon ("Marvel's The Avengers") version of the famous Shakespeare play is a fresh and innovative take on one of the famous playwright's brilliant comedies. "Much Ado About Nothing" retains the language of the play in a modern and contemporary setting using many of the directors notable actors and filmed in black and white. Worth checking out even if you don't like Shakespeare. Weekend Box Office - "Cloudy With a Chance of Meatballs 2" was number one with $35 million, "Prisoners" was number two with $11 million, and "Rush" opened at number three with $10 million.
 
 
                                                                             
 
"Gravity" starring George Clooney and Sandra Bullock is the nerve wracking tale of an astronaut who during a routine space mission, suddenly finds herself adrift and spinning helplessly in space.

Also available today on DVD & Blu-ray is the apocalyptic comedy "This Is The End" which features a variety of the actors portraying distorted versions of themselves as popularized by Neil Patrick Harris in the Harold and Kumar movies. James Franco, Jonah Hill, Seth Rogen, Jay Baruchel, Danny McBride, Craig Robinson, Michael Cera, and Emma Watson, as well as many others round out the cast in this dark comedy.
